51CTO博客已为您找到关于npm run build:prod的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及npm run build:prod问答内容。更多npm run build:prod相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
在npm run build --prod命令中,--prod标志是用于指定构建过程中的生产环境标志。它告诉构建工具(如Webpack或Angular CLI)以生产模式进行构建,以便优化代码并减小生成的文件大小。 具体来说,--prod标志会触发以下行为: 代码优化:构建工具会对代码进行优化,包括删除未使用的代码、压缩代码、提取公共模块等,以减小...
5:重新执行命令,npm run build:prod,即可
// 命令:npm run build -- test ,process.env.HOST就设置为:'test' let HOST = process.env.HOST; HOST = HOST === 'prod' ? '' : '-' + HOST; apiUrl = 'http://api'+HOST+'.demo.com'; axios.defaults.baseURL = apiUrl; 4.最后敲命令: npm run build -- test 注意–是2个横杠, ...
51CTO博客已为您找到关于npm run build 命令的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及npm run build 命令问答内容。更多npm run build 命令相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
2、修改根目录下的webpack.prod.config.js 文件 把publicPath修改一下,修改为'/IView3/dist/' 最下面还有一个HtmlWebpackPlugin的配置也要修改一下: 直接把原来的index_prod.html修改为index.html。 3、然后就编译发布吧。 npm run build 4、把生成的dist目录还有index.html拷贝到我的IView3目录下面去。
正式环境:npm run build:prod 对应process.ev.NODE_ENV = 'production';生成build文件夹 修改package.json->browserslist 项目中就能使用process.env.NODE_ENV来区分三个环境。 方法二: > 自带webpack配置中默认配置使用dotenv来处理 > npm install dotenv-cli --save-dev ...
已解决,是prod配置问题,prod用的是mock,这段去掉就行// if (process.env.NODE_ENV === 'production') {// const { mockXHR } = require('../mock')// mockXHR()// } 有用 回复 抱歉_你想多了 8431826 发布于 2020-09-18 看提示像是把对象当方法用了 ...具体的需要点进去查一下,我猜:...
1、优化之前 是 2、去掉console.log、警告、注释、debugger 参照:https://blog.csdn.net/lmy0111ly/article/details/93979006 https://www.cnblogs.com/jishugaochao/p/10180416.html webpack.prod.conf中UglifyJsPlugin配置 线上去掉查看源码功能:sourceMap:false ...
npm run build 相同的任务,但会针对生产环境进行特定的优化和设置。在一些构建工具中,如 Vue CLI 和 Create React App,npm run build 和 npm run build:prod 是等效的命令,都用于构建生产环境代码。但在其他情况下,这两个命令可能有不同的用途和配置,需要具体根据项目的需要进行设置。